1 mr-mathematics.com Recapping: Writing a ratio
What is the ratio of square numbers to prime numbers between 1 and 30 in its simplest form? ANS mr-mathematics.com

2 mr-mathematics.com Sharing in a Given Ratio
Learning Objective: Divide a quantity into two parts when given a ratio. a) Divide 20 in the ratio 2 : 3. b) Divide £24 in the ratio 3 : 5 c) Simon is 10 years old and Becci is 15 years old. Divide £1.75 between in the ratio of their ages. d) The angles in a quadrilateral are in the ratio 3 : 5 : 6 : 4. Find the value of each angle. ANS ANS ANS ANS mr-mathematics.com

3 mr-mathematics.com Sharing in a Given Ratio
Learning Objective: Divide a quantity into two parts when given a ratio. a) Divide £36 in the following ratios. i) 1 : 5 ii) 1 : 3 iii) 4 : 5 iv) 11 : 7 b) Find the larger amount when each quantity below is divided in the given ratio. i) 250 ml in the ratio 2 : 3 ii) 32 cm in the ratio 3 : 5 iii) £48 in the ratio 5 : 7 iv) 64 kg in the ratio 15 : 17 c) The perimeter of a rectangle is 120 cm. The lengths are in the ratio 1 : 3. Calculate the area of the rectangle. ANS ANS ANS ANS ANS ANS ANS ANS ANS mr-mathematics.com

4 mr-mathematics.com Sharing in a Given Ratio
Learning Objective: Divide a quantity into two parts when given a ratio. The ratio of shaded to unshaded squares in this rectangle is 1 : 5. How many more squares need to be shaded to make the ratio 3 : 5? ANS mr-mathematics.com
